Comparing Efficiency in 1X Operation to Efficiency in 2X
Operation
Efficiency of at least 98 to 100% indicates a high quality signal. Check the signal quality
numerous times, at various times of day and on various days of the week (as you checked the RF
environment a variety of times by spectrum analysis before placing radios in the area). Efficiency
less than 90% in 1X operation or less than 60% in 2X operation indicates a link with problems that
require action.
When to Switch from 2X to 1X Operation Based on 60%
Link Efficiency
In the above latter case (60% in 2X operation), the link experiences worse latency (from packet
resends) than it would in 1X operation, but still greater capacity, if the link remains stable at 60%
Efficiency. Downlink Efficiency and Uplink Efficiency are measurements produced by running a
link test from either the SM or the AP. Examples of what action should be taken based on
Efficiency in 2X operation are provided in Table 32.
